  8. What is this rambling about capture card?

    He says that he got a DV camcorder.

    He needs a Firewire-card.

    http://www.ubid.com/actn/opn/getpage.asp?AuctionId=8115126

    You can transfer the DV data with Moviemaker that comes
    with WindowsXP.


    Hint: Defrag Hard drive first.
